March vs the best time to visit Kodaikanal
The best months to visit Kodaikanal are April, May, September, December and the months to avoid are July, November. March sits outside peak season, which often means better value and thinner crowds.

Kodaikanal Lake Boating
A man-made star-shaped lake at the heart of town, ringed by a 5km path for walking or cycling, with pedal and rowing boats available on the water.
Coaker's Walk
A narrow paved pathway along a ridge offering sweeping views over the plains below — especially atmospheric when clouds roll through at sunrise.
Pillar Rocks
Three massive vertical rock formations rising over 400 feet from the forest, framed by deep valleys — one of Kodaikanal's most photographed sights.
Bryant Park
A well-maintained botanical garden established during the colonial era, known for its flower shows, hybridised roses, and a glasshouse nursery.
Pine Forest (Bombay Shola) Walk
A tall, fragrant pine plantation popular for short walks and photography, with sunlight filtering dramatically through the trees.
Dolphin's Nose Viewpoint
A cliff-edge viewpoint offering a vertigo-inducing drop and views over the Vaigai plains far below — a quieter alternative to the busier lookout points.
